Alina Habba’s Meme: A Comparison of Herself to Taylor Swift

In a recent social media post, Alina Habba, a lawyer for former President Donald Trump, shared a meme that compared her favorably to pop star Taylor Swift. The meme juxtaposed images of the two women with the caption, “Who thinks this country needs a lot more women like Alina Habba, and a lot less like Taylor Swift?” This post sparked a flurry of reactions, with some supporting Habba’s sentiment and others criticizing her for using Swift as a political pawn.

Taylor Swift’s Political Endorsements

Taylor Swift has been vocal about her political views in recent years, endorsing candidates and speaking out against policies that she believes are harmful. In the 2020 presidential election, Swift endorsed Joe Biden and Kamala Harris, and she has also criticized Trump’s administration on numerous occasions.
